Abstract

The utility model belongs to the technical field of breathing masks, and discloses an anesthetic breathing mask, which comprises a mask main body and a hollow threaded column; the mask body is an annular hollow transparent shell; the side of the mask body facing the wearer is an open end; an air cushion is arranged at the edge of the open end; an opening is arranged right above the mask main body; a hollow threaded adjusting pipe is arranged at the opening; the inner wall of the threaded adjusting pipe is provided with an internal thread; the hollow threaded column comprises a hollow column body and a bite block; the tooth pad is provided with an arc-shaped connecting sheet; the outer wall of the hollow cylinder is provided with external threads; the bottom end of the hollow column body is connected with the connecting sheet of the bite block; the external thread of the hollow cylinder is in threaded connection with the internal thread of the threaded adjusting pipe. The hollow cylinder is connected with the thread adjusting pipe in a threaded manner, the position of the bite-block can be adjusted to adapt to facial signs of different patients, the hollow cylinder is connected with the thread adjusting pipe and the bite-block in a hard manner, the bite-block can be prevented from being spitted out during operation, and the smooth operation is effectively guaranteed.

Background
Gastroscopy is a medical examination method, also referred to as an instrument used for such examination. Patients suffering from asthma, heart failure, obesity and the like often suffer from clinical work, and the patients have dyspnea in the oxygen inhalation process due to physical reasons of the patients, so that the bite block is spit out. The existing anesthesia respirator is generally composed of a mask and a tooth pad, the tooth pad is located below an interface, a medical staff is usually required to lift the jaw of a patient with one hand, or after the anesthesia respirator is taken off, the tooth pad is fixed in a manually adjusted position in the mouth of the patient, and then the tooth pad is inserted into a gastroscope tube, so that the operation process is extremely complicated and is not beneficial to oxygen inhalation in the operation of the patient, and the operation risk is increased. In addition, the face mask and the dental pad of the split structure are required to be respectively fixed on the head part of a patient by an elastic band in the anesthesia process of the patient in the prior clinical operation, the dental pad is worn on the head by an elastic band strap, some patients can spit out the dental pad in the operation process, the patient is in a general anesthesia state, and the mouth of the patient is difficult to bite after the dental pad is spit out, so that the operation cannot be performed.

Example 1
As shown in fig. 1 to 2: the utility model provides an anesthetic breathing mask, which comprises a mask main body 1, an air cushion 2, an oxygen pipe 3, an inflation inlet 7 and a hollow threaded column 4.
The mask body 1 is an annular hollow transparent shell; the side of the mask body 1 facing the patient is an open end; the open end is provided with a soft annular air cushion 2 for covering the mouth and nose of a patient, the air cushion 2 is connected with an air charging port 7, the inner side of the air charging port 7 is provided with a one-way valve, and the air charging port 7 can be fixedly connected with external equipment and is used for charging air to the air cushion 2; an oxygen pipe 3 is arranged on the mask main body 1 in the direction of wearing the head of the patient, and the oxygen pipe 3 is used for connecting an anesthesia machine, so that anesthetic and oxygen can be conveyed into the mask main body 1; an opening is arranged right above the mask body 1, a plurality of headband fixing columns 6 are arranged on the outer surface of the opening, the headband fixing columns 6 can be connected with tightening belts, one ends of the tightening belts are fixed with the mask body 1, and the mask body 1 is fixed on the head of a patient through the tightening belts.
As shown in fig. 3 to 4: a hollow threaded adjusting pipe 11 is fixed on the opening right above the mask main body 1, and the inner wall of the threaded adjusting pipe 11 is provided with internal threads. The hollow threaded column 4 comprises a hollow column body 40, and external threads are arranged on the outer wall of the hollow column body 40; the external thread of the hollow cylinder 40 can be screwed with the internal thread of the threaded adjusting tube 11. The bottom end of the hollow column 40 is connected with an arc-shaped connecting piece 42 of the bite block 41. The hollow column 40 is hollow and is communicated with the through hole of the tooth pad 41, and can be used for inserting a gastroscopy tube when a patient performs gastroscopy.
The hollow column body 40 is in threaded fit with the threaded adjusting pipe 11, the top of the hollow column body 40 penetrates out of the threaded adjusting pipe 11 and is exposed outside the threaded adjusting pipe 11, and the height of the bite block 41 in the mask main body 1 can be adjusted by twisting the hollow column body 40 so as to adapt to facial features of different patients, so that the bite block 41 can be snapped by different patients; after the position of the bite block 41 is adjusted, an adjusting nut 5 can be arranged on the hollow column body 40 and screwed on the top of the threaded adjusting tube 11, so that the hollow column body 40 and the threaded adjusting tube 11 are well fixed together, the position of the hollow column body 40 in the threaded adjusting tube 11 is kept, and the bite block 41 can be smoothly snapped according to the facial conditions of different patients; the hollow column body 40 and the threaded adjusting tube 11 are mechanically and firmly fixed, so that the bite block 41 cannot be spit out by a patient during operation, and the smooth operation and the safety are ensured.
As shown in fig. 5, the two sides of the mask body 1, which are close to the connecting pieces 42, are respectively provided with elastic bands 8, when in use, besides the mask body 1 is fixed on the head of a patient through the tightening bands, the bite-block 41 is also fixed on the head of the patient through the elastic bands 8, the position of the bite-block 41 is doubly ensured, and the patient can not spit out the bite-block during operation.
Example 2
As shown in fig. 6 to 7: the utility model provides an anesthesia respirator, which is provided with a bite-block fixing band on the basis of an embodiment 1; the fixing strap includes a first adjustment strap 80 disposed on one side of the connecting strap 42 and a second adjustment strap 81 disposed on the other side of the connecting strap 42. The tail end of the first adjusting belt 80 is provided with a locking block 801, the second adjusting belt 81 is provided with a plurality of clamping teeth, the second adjusting belt 81 passes through the locking block 801 of the first adjusting belt 80, and the clamping teeth on the second adjusting belt 81 are matched with the clamping teeth in the locking block 801 and can firmly fix the tooth pad 41 in the mouth of a patient; the first adjusting strap 80 and the second adjusting strap 81 are made of hard plastic, have no elasticity, can firmly fix the bite block 41 in the mouth of a patient, and cannot eject the bite block 41 through the tongue in an anesthetic state of the patient.
Further, the hollow column body 40 and the threaded adjusting tube 11 are made of hard transparent plastic; the hollow cylinder 40 has external threads and the threaded adjusting tube 11 has internal threads; the hollow column 40 is connected with the thread adjusting pipe 11 through the middle thread, and the height position of the bite block 41 in the mask main body 1 can be adjusted by rotating the hollow column 40 so as to adapt to facial features of different patients, so that the patients can bite the bite block 41 during the operation.
Further, the hollow column 40 and the bite block 41 are provided as a unitary structure and are connected by a connecting piece 42 therebetween.
Further, the connecting piece 42 is in a backward curved arc shape which is matched with the lips of a human body, and the thickness is 1mm-2mm.
Further, the first adjusting belt 80 on one side and the second adjusting belt 81 on the other side of the connecting piece 42 may be made of nylon material, and a locking block 801 matched with the tooth profile of the second adjusting belt 81 is arranged at the bottom end of the first adjusting belt 80.
The anesthetic breathing mask is provided with a channel which is convenient for gastroscopy, and is provided with a hollow column body 40 and a threaded adjusting pipe 11, wherein the hollow column body 40 is in threaded connection with the threaded adjusting pipe 11, the height position of a bite block 41 in a mask main body 1 can be adjusted by rotating the hollow column body 40, and the bite block is prevented from being spit out by a patient in the operation process in a hard connection mode; manual adjustment may also be performed to help the patient fix the position of the bite block 41 to prevent the bite block 41 from scratching the mouth and lips. Secondly, according to the anesthesia respirator disclosed by the utility model, the bottom end of the hollow column body 40 and the connecting sheet 42 of the tooth pad 41 are integrally arranged, the lower end of the connecting sheet 42 is connected with the tooth pad 41, and the hollow column body 40 is in threaded fit with the threaded adjusting tube 11 by adopting an integral structure, so that the tooth pad 41 is prevented from falling in a mouth of a patient, and the reliability of equipment is improved. Finally, according to the anesthesia respirator disclosed by the utility model, the left side of the mask main body 1, which is close to the connecting sheet 4, is provided with the first adjusting belt 80, the right side of the connecting sheet 4 is provided with the second adjusting belt 81, the port of the first adjusting belt 80 is provided with the locking block 801, the second adjusting belt 81 penetrates through the locking block 801 of the first adjusting belt 80 to fix the binding belt on the head of a patient, and the length adjustment is carried out on the sizes of different heads of different patients, so that the fixing reliability is improved, and the tooth pad 41 is further prevented from falling in the mouth of the patient.
